Position Overview:

The Program Manager of Agency Support Brokerage manages the Agency Support Brokerage department, ensuring quality service delivery. This hybrid position combines remote and in-person work, with specific office days based on team needs.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Supervision and Management: Oversee the Agency Support Brokerage team, facilitate meetings, manage performance, and handle day-to-day operations.
  • Case Management: Oversee a small caseload of individuals in the program, ensuring health and safety and program satisfaction.
  • Community Engagement: Build relationships with community partners, assist with recruitment and enroll individuals in programs as needed.
  • Relationship Development: Maintain regular contact with supported individuals and families to ensure program satisfaction.
  • Interdisciplinary Collaboration: Participate in support meetings and collaborate with other program managers on system updates.
  • Intake: Support the intake process and develop initial Self Direction plans in line with person-centered standards.
  • Compliance: Ensure adherence to OPWDD regulations and agency policies, including training on relevant regulations.
  • Case Management Oversight: Maintain accurate documentation and communication regarding services provided.
  • Advocacy: Advocate for the rights and needs of supported individuals, facilitating access to necessary resources.
  • Reporting: Ensure proper reporting and investigation of incidents as per regulatory requirements.
  • Professional Development: Attend trainings and seek development opportunities to further professional goals.
  • Perform other duties as required.

Qualifications

  • Age Requirement: Minimum age of 18.
  • Experience: 2+ years in OPWDD HCBS Waiver programs required; supervisory experience preferred.
  • Educational Qualification: Bachelor’s degree in a related field preferred.
  • Certifications: Support Broker Authorization required.
  • Driver's Status: Valid License preferred; ability to travel required.
  • Physical Demands: Tasks may involve assisting with toileting and hygiene, with accommodations available for individuals with disabilities.
